Cultural Competence Toolkit

The Final Project for this course is to construct a Diversity Toolkit, which will demonstrate the knowledge, skills, resources, and strategies you have obtained as an early childhood professional as well as defining and illustrating your relevant beliefs and philosophies. Your toolkit will be a statement of who you are and a demonstration of your learning throughout the course and your professional life.

Your Diversity Toolkit will be delivered to Waypoint from this assignment and also uploaded to your e-portfolio from Week 3 as a project.

Imagine you have completed your studies and are serving as an early childhood educator or administrator. This week you are going to prepare a virtual toolkit that will be available online for your families, peers, and administrators. Prior to beginning this assignment, review the National Education Association’s (NEA’s) resource Diversity Toolkit: Cultural Competence for Educators (Links to an external site.).

Your project will include a section for each of the five basic cultural competence skills areas identified in the NEA resource: valuing diversity, being culturally self-aware, the dynamics of difference, knowledge of students’ culture, and institutionalizing cultural knowledge and adapting to diversity.

In the Valuing Diversity section,

  • Explain how you create accepting and respectful environments for different cultural backgrounds and customs, different ways of communicating, and different traditions and values.
  • Explain how you foster a home-school partnership.
  • Describe one diversity activity that you would implement in an environment that families can be a part of. You can use your Week 4 Assignments and Discussions to help with this.

In the Being Culturally Self-Aware section,

  • State your cultural competence philosophy.
  • Describe two or three ways to incorporate your philosophy into an understanding and respectful early childhood environment.
  • Discuss two to three obstacles you might encounter when creating a culturally relevant learning environment.
  • Identify ways to address these challenges.

In the Dynamics of Difference section,

  • Develop an activity that you can share with children and families to encourage and support respect for difference and other cultures. Be sure your activity description gives sufficient detail so that families will gain a clear understanding of what they are doing and why they are doing it.

In the Knowledge of Students’ Culture section,

  • Describe the types of culturally relevant and anti-bias curriculum you will use in learning environments so families can understand how learning is organized in your early learning setting.
  • Provide a graphic showing the main components of culturally relevant and anti-bias curriculum.
